Trail Overview

This is a smooth, hard-packed gravel road that travels through the National Forest. This trail is suitable for any vehicle type and leads to the Pewee Falls overlook trailhead. At the end of the trail, there is a parking lot, a flushing toilet restroom with power and a sink, and a building overlooking the dam with information boards. The trail has a warning sign for a "steep road," but that sign is not correct, as the trail gradually climbs only about 200' in elevation. Cell phone service was decent along this trail, and the full bathroom with power is the only amenity available. The nearest services and supplies are to the south in Metaline Falls, Washington.
